Sentara Hospitals

101 Sentara Hospitals is a not-for-profit integrated healthcare provider based in Virginia and Northeastern North Carolina, with a legacy of over 131 years. The organization operates hundreds of care sites, including 12 hospitals, home health services, hospice, medical groups, imaging services, therapy, outpatient surgery centers, and a health plan serving 858,000 members. Sentara is committed to diversity, inclusion, and belonging within its workforce of nearly 30,000 members, reflecting the communities it serves. Recognized as an 'Employer of Choice' for over a decade and celebrated by U.S. News and World Report for having the Best Hospitals for more than 15 years, Sentara is dedicated to improving health every day while providing professional development opportunities and maintaining a tobacco-free environment.
